The African Union (AU) has condemned a “wave” of military coups that has seen an unprecedented number of member states suspended from the bloc, a senior official said on Sunday, the last day of its annual summit.
The coups were among the main issues expected to be discussed at the summit, along with the AU’s response to a war in the north of host country Ethiopia.
